Renewal of AiB Insolvency Services Contract

   22 May 2012

The Accountant in Bankruptcy Framework Agreement for the supply of Insolvency Services was introduced in April 2009 for a three year period with the option to extend for a further 12 months. The Accountant in Bankruptcy exercised the 12 month extension option, resulting in an expiry date of 31 March 2013. There will be no further extension to the current framework.
 
The Insolvency Services Framework allows The Accountant in Bankruptcy to use external Providers to administer bankruptcy cases on her behalf, where she has been appointed as trustee.
 
Work has now commenced on the strategy for a new framework or contract to be in place for 1 April 2013.
 
A Prior Information Notice (PIN) has been advertised on Public Contracts Scotland (PCS) web portal and in the Official Journal of the European Union (OJEU), letting potential bidders know of the forthcoming tender.  Interested parties can access the PIN by registering on the PCS Portal.
 
The Pre-Qualification Questionnaire and/or the tender documents should be available to interested suppliers around September/October 2012 and will be published in the OJEU and the PCS portal. 
 
If you are an interested supplier, and haven’t already done so, you should register on the PCS and note interest in Financial Services. You should be automatically alerted to any future notices advertised under this commodity.
